Managed to install my xmas present the other day. Pioneer Stereo.... Love it - sound is very good, cool light show, about 20 different colors. Installed new speakers in rear - I had a pair of 6" sonys from my boat -- worked nice.
Unit is 4" tall hole is 3 1/2", with trim removed hole is about 3 3/4", loosen up the HVAC controller and it shoe horned in. Had to carve up the trim ring and I bought a Ford retro kit from walmart cause they had 4" trim pcs, worked well ..
Polished tail lights up, shaping up.
